- Rome is extraordinary – but it also happens to be one of the finest launchpads in all of Italy.
- Within a couple of hours in any direction, you can be standing in the ruins of Pompeii, sipping wine in the Tuscan countryside, gazing up at Florence's Duomo, or tracing the cliff-hugging curves of the Amalfi Coast.
- The Eternal City gives you access to an astonishing range of landscapes, history, and flavours, all in a single day.
- This guide covers the best day trips from Rome – close-range escapes in the Lazio region, half-day options for those short on time, and longer excursions for travellers willing to make an early start.
- Rome is best known for its unparalleled concentration of ancient, Renaissance, and baroque heritage.
- The city served as the political and cultural heart of the Roman Empire for centuries, and that legacy is visible everywhere – in its ruins, its churches, its piazzas, and its museums.
- Most famous fountain: The Trevi Fountain (Fontana di Trevi).
- UNESCO World Heritage Sites: Historic Centre of Rome (1980).
- Enclave within the city: Vatican City – the world's smallest country.
